    I have a small golden doodle and a small bernedoodle and recently started coming to Pampered Paws N Play for grooming. Both my boys have very long curly hair and I always felt so bad taking them to my last groomer because they would be 6+ hour appointments. After both my pups coming to Pampered Paws N Play for grooming services I can say that Danielle does an AMAZING job. Not only does she consult with you on what you'd like done, she gets it done in 3 hours or less. Danielle even let me know that my bernedoodle is terrified of the dryer and she worked around having to use the large dryer on him so he wasn't so terrified. I truly am so happy with the service here and I am happy the boys finally found their forever groomer and they are happy too!!

Back in the day when you wanted to take your dog there you took them for an interview essentially. Fisher would spend time with your dog and they could judge your dogs temperament and see if your dog was going to get along with other dogs or had behavioral issues. They still do that and have even improved on the process by having an on line form that allows you to document all your dogs shots as well as any health issues or any issues they might need to know about your dog. When you schedule the interview, you go over the whole form as well as going over all the house rules. For example maintaining six foot distances from each parent coming or going from the lobby. Keeping your dog outside the door till a dog of a different size who may be in the lobby leaves to prevent any possible large dog small dog issues for example. Then they take your dog to see how their temperament is with other dogs. Just as they did before , they check to see if your dog is social or has some issues that may not make it possible for your dog go there. After that if your dog is accepted, you schedule your dogs days at Fisher. They also have an in house groomer so you can have your dog washed and groomed while it's there. The staff has always had a consistently friendly attitude and knows your dog by name and greets them enthusiastically and encouragingly. Which is very helpful for a shy dog to help them adjust.
